个人做网站该选轻量应用服务器还是云服务器ECS?新手建站怎么选合适
很多刚开始接触建站的个人用户在准备购买云服务器时,会面对两个选项:轻量应用服务器和云服务器ECS。这两个产品都可用于部署个人网站,但适用方式和使用体验存在明显差异。
轻量应用服务器适合哪些个人建站场景
轻量应用服务器主要面向单机、轻负载的应用部署需求。对于个人用户来说,以下几类典型场景更匹配该产品:
- 搭建个人博客或作品展示站
- 部署小型静态网站或前端项目
- 运行低频访问的小程序后端服务
- 测试或学习 Web 开发环境
- 使用 WordPress、Typecho 等 CMS 快速建站
这类服务器通常提供预装镜像,例如 LAMP、Node.js、WordPress 等,用户在控制台选择对应模板后,几分钟内即可完成环境部署,无需手动安装配置 Web 服务、数据库或 SSL 证书。
“我只是想搭个博客,不想折腾服务器配置,有没有开箱即用的方案?”
云服务器ECS更适合什么情况
云服务器ECS属于通用型计算实例,提供完整的操作系统控制权限。当个人网站出现以下特征时,ECS 更为合适:
- 需要自定义系统内核或网络参数
- 计划后期扩展为多服务架构(如前后端分离、独立数据库)
- 需对接负载均衡、对象存储、云数据库等其他云产品
- 对安全组、VPC 网络、快照备份等高级功能有明确需求
- 打算长期运营并可能面临访问量增长
ECS 允许用户通过 SSH 完全控制系统,自由安装任意软件版本,灵活调整资源配置。但这也意味着用户需自行处理环境搭建、安全加固、日志监控等运维任务。
两者在资源和管理方式上的关键区别
| 对比维度 | 轻量应用服务器 | 云服务器ECS |
|---|---|---|
| 资源配置方式 | CPU、内存、带宽捆绑销售,不可单独调整 | CPU、内存、带宽、磁盘可独立配置 |
| 操作系统控制 | 支持基础命令操作,部分底层权限受限 | 完全 root 权限,可深度定制系统 |
| 网络能力 | 仅支持公网IP,不支持绑定弹性公网IP或加入VPC专有网络 | 支持弹性公网IP、私有网络、安全组策略等完整网络功能 |
| 运维界面 | 提供集成化控制台,含一键部署、流量监控、防火墙设置 | 依赖云平台通用控制台,需配合其他工具实现可视化运维 |
| 扩展性 | 升级需整体更换套餐,无法横向扩容 | 支持垂直扩容(升配)和水平扩容(加机器) |
实际部署示例对比
以部署一个基于 Node.js 的个人 API 服务为例:
轻量应用服务器方式:
1. 在控制台选择“Node.js 应用镜像”
2. 启动实例后自动安装 Node、Nginx、PM2
3. 上传代码至指定目录,服务自动运行
4. 通过内置防火墙开放端口,绑定域名即可访问
云服务器ECS方式:
1. 购买 Ubuntu 系统实例
2. SSH 登录后手动安装 Node.js、Nginx
3. 配置反向代理、PM2 守护进程
4. 设置安全组规则开放 80/443 端口
5. 手动申请并配置 SSL 证书
前者省去了大量中间步骤,后者则保留了全部控制自由。
FAQ:购买前常见问题
轻量应用服务器能跑数据库吗?
可以。部分镜像已集成 MySQL 或 MariaDB,也可手动安装轻量级数据库。但因资源固定,不适合高并发读写场景。
以后网站流量大了能迁移到ECS吗?
可以迁移,但需重新部署环境和数据。轻量服务器不支持直接变更为ECS实例,两者属于不同产品线。
轻量服务器是否支持自定义域名和HTTPS?
支持绑定自定义域名,也支持通过控制台一键申请免费SSL证书并启用HTTPS,无需手动配置。
做个人项目练手选哪个更合适?
若目标是快速看到成果、减少环境配置时间,轻量应用服务器更合适;若希望深入学习Linux运维和服务器管理,ECS提供更真实的实践环境。
轻量应用服务器有使用期限限制吗?
没有强制使用期限,按购买周期计费(如1年),到期后可续费继续使用。